Mangaluru, August 7, 2025: In a prestigious event at Kudmul Ranga Rao Town Hall on Wednesday (August 6), Alva’s Education Foundation Chairman Dr. M. Mohan Alva received the esteemed Suvarna Sambhrama Award from the Dakshina Kannada District Working Journalists’ Association. This grand ceremony was part of the association’s golden jubilee celebration, with the honor bestowed in recognition of Dr. Alva’s significant contributions. The occasion was graced by the presence of former Chief Minister D.V. Sadananda Gowda, who underscored the media’s pivotal role in championing truth and ethical standards during his inaugural address.
D.V. Sadananda Gowda Calls for Responsible Journalism
In his speech, DV Sadananda Gowda emphasized the significant growth of the media environment driven by technology. He called on the media to prioritize disseminating factual information without embellishments for the sake of society. He expressed concern over social media misuse and its detrimental effects on societal well-being. Gowda encouraged journalists to maintain neutrality, enabling audiences to form independent opinions. He underscored the importance of objective reporting for achieving impactful journalism.
Dr. M. Mohan Alva emphasized the mutually beneficial connection between democracy and journalism in his acceptance speech. Highlighting the necessity of trust, commitment, and ethical principles in every report, he called for a form of journalism that honors public opinion and adheres to high moral standards. Additionally, a documentary chronicling the association's journey was premiered by former MP Nalin Kumar Kateel.
Photography Contest Winners honored
As part of the grand festivities, a highly competitive state-level photography competition took place, showcasing the immense talent of photographers across the region. The esteemed first prize was clinched by none other than Eerappa Naykar, hailing from the renowned publication, Kannada Prabha in Hubballi. Following closely in the rankings, M.S. Basavanna from Kannada Prabha (Mysuru) secured the second position, while Udayashankar of The Indian Express (Mysuru) claimed the third spot. The prestigious award ceremony was graced by the presence of distinguished guests such as MLAs Vedavyas Kamath, Dr. Y. Bharat Shetty, and Rajesh Naik. The event also drew in a number of senior journalists and influential figures from the media industry.
The event was hosted by P.B. Harish Rai, with Srinivas Indaje, president of the journalists’ association, delivering the keynote address. Anand Shetty, founder president of Mangaluru Press Club, gave the introductory remarks, and Jitendra Kundeshwar proposed the vote of thanks.
